A kind of neutral phenolic foam plastic and preparation method thereof
A phenolic foam, neutral technology, applied in the field of phenolic foam, can solve the problems of building surface corrosion, complicated process, difficult process, etc., and achieve the effect of low cost, simple preparation process and short time consumption

Embodiment 1
[0033] The weight proportion of each component of neutral phenolic foam plastics is:
[0034] Expandable phenolic resin: 100 parts;
[0035] Surfactant: Tween-80, 5 parts;
[0036] Foaming agent: n-pentane, 6 parts;
[0037] Composite alkali metal salt: 15 parts, including 12 parts of barium carbonate and 3 parts of anhydrous sodium acetate;
[0038] Curing agent: p-toluenesulfonic acid, 18 parts.
[0039] Preparation process: at room temperature, mix expandable phenolic resin, surfactant and foaming agent according to the formula composition, stir evenly, then add complex alkali metal salt and curing agent, stir evenly at high speed, and immediately pour the mixture into the mold Then put the mold into an oven at 75°C, keep it for 25 minutes and then take out the phenolic foam from the mold to obtain a foam density of 45kg / m 3 .
Embodiment 2
[0041] The weight proportion of each component of neutral phenolic foam plastics is:
[0042] Expandable phenolic resin: 100g;
[0043] Surfactant: Tween-60, 6g;
[0044] Foaming agent: petroleum ether, 6.5g;
[0045] Compound alkali metal salt: 18g, including 15g of barium carbonate and 3g of sodium lactate pentahydrate;
[0046] Curing agent: phenolsulfonic acid, 18g.
[0047] The preparation process is the same as in Example 1, and after testing, the obtained density is 48kg / m 3 phenolic foam.
Embodiment 3
[0049] The weight ratio of each component of the phenolic foam plastic is:
[0050] Expandable phenolic resin: 100g;
[0051] Surfactant: PEG-25, 4g;
[0052] Foaming agent: cyclohexane, 4.5g;
[0053] Compound alkali metal salt: 20g, including 15g of barium carbonate, 3g of anhydrous sodium acetate, and 2g of trisodium phosphate;
[0054] Curing agent: phenolsulfonic acid, 20g.
[0055] The preparation process is the same as in Example 1, and after testing, the obtained density is 47kg / m 3 phenolic foam.
